The large man. drum brakes have always worked good 4 me in dry condition's, rain is another story.
As far as a disc swap I would look at 72-74 e body, 73-76 a body disc as they are not that hard to find and you can swap over the caliper brackets and use the later larger rotors.

I had a 4 wheel drum PB car. The brakes had good initial bite but weren't very even left/right and front rear. Also they weren't good at speed.

Its mostly the fronts that need upgrade. There are lots of ways to do it. Check out Mopar Action Tech pages. You'll find a step by step guide on how to use standard MOPAR front disc brakes from later years. Master Power Brakes also sells complete kits with stock type parts. Either setup should dramatically improve braking performance.

Much bigger front brakes and rear discs are available also depending on how far you want to go.

Staying with manual brakes will work with the upgrade - just make sure you keep master cylinder diameter on the small side so pedal effort isn't too high... or upgrade to power if you prefer.

Most likley you'll need to change the front spindles so the level of difficulty is similar to a front end rebuild.
